        <![CDATA[ I ordered this radio with remote control. I will be mounting the unit in the saddlebag and the remote on the bars. It is an AM/FM Mp3 CD compatible radio. With the Mp3 option, I can burn a CD with over 200 Mp3's and not have to change CD's on an entire trip! The main unit is only 7&quot;X7&quot;X2&quot;. It will take very little room in the bag. It is also a Marine radio that is water resistant! Me thinks me gonna like this!!!!!!!

			<description><![CDATA[ <p>I&#39;d like to get a radio/CD/MP3 player with a hadlebar remote.  I went to an MP3 player about 4 years ago because the vibration from the bike didn&#39;t
allow the CD player to track consistently.  Even with a 12 second shock memory, it didn&#39;t function at high speeds on the slab.  With no moving parts, an
MP3 player doesn&#39;t have a problem with vibration.
